The Tucson Fire Department returned from a call to find the station filled with smoke and a fire on the kitchen stove, Saturday evening.
The Station 11 crew put out the flames with a fire extinguisher. Other units assisted in confirming the fire was actually out.
The firefighters had been cooking dinner when they were dispatched on a call and didn't turn off the stove. The fire damaged cabinets and the ceiling and there was smoke damage throughout the main area of the station.
